Zelenskyy confirms he is considering replacing Ukraine’s military chief
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y, centre, during his visit to Zaporizhzhia region on Sunday (Picture: Ukrainian Presidential Press Office via AP)
Ukraine’s President Volodymyr Zelenskyy said he was weighing up a possible dismissal of the country’s top military officer, a prospect that has shocked the nation fighting Russia’s invasion and worried Kyiv’s Western allies.
Asked whether he was considering the ousting of General Valerii Zaluzhnyi, Mr Zelenskyy told Italian RAI TV in an interview released late on Sunday that he was thinking about it as part of a broader issue of setting the country’s path.
